Middle-class patients and their families are among those driven to rage by long waits and dehumanising care in corridors, the Royal College of Nursing said.

Nurses have reported being punched, hit and spat at.

A senior A&E nurse said she has seen colleagues punched, kicked and even had a gun pointed at them
